AOB Job Posting: Marketing Coordinator

Position Overview: American Outdoor Brands is proud to create some of the industry’s most popular products for enthusiasts across many outdoor recreational activities. As an established leader in the outdoor space, we strive to hire the most passionate employees that understand the needs of our consumer base. The Marketing Coordinator is a pivotal role to help coordinate the efforts of the Brand Managers and support the broader marketing team. This role will primarily be responsible for copywriting support for each brand, working directly with Digital Marketing Specialist to execute vision for online marketing campaigns, contract management and organization, auditing content alignment with brand positioning, disseminating content to internal and external partners, assisting with merchandising and trade marketing, planning and coordinating grass root events and tradeshows, and supporting with any needed brand management task.
